Father guilty of daughter’s rape

By Joyetter Feagaimaali’i-Luamanu 25 May 2018, 12:00AM

A 40-year-old father has admitted raping his 16-year-old biological daughter twice. 

The matter was presented before Supreme Court Justice Tafaoimalo Leilani Tuala-Warren.

She issued a suppression order on the name of the defendant. 

The father is charged with rape and incest. 

The matter was initially scheduled for a trial, however defense Lawyer, Diana Roma, informed the Court the defendant wishes to enter a guilty plea. 

Prosecuting was Assistant Attorney General, Rexona Titi. She did not object. 

According to the Police summary of facts on this case, two sexual incidents occurred on January and September 2017. 

The Police report notes that the first incident occurred when the victim was asleep when she suddenly felt someone removing her shorts. 

The father then blocked her face with a pillow and raped her. 

She told the Police her parents argued on the night in question. 

The second incident occurred in September, 2017 where the victim was cooking. Her father took her into a bedroom and had sex with her. 

The Police report further says the victim told her mother about what happened and when her mother confronted her father, he turned around and assaulted her. 

The father entered a guilty plea through his lawyer to the two sex charges. 

Justice Tafaoimalo has scheduled sentencing for the father on 13 June, 2018 at 12:30pm.
